1994 BMW 735 vs. 1996 Nissan Primera

To start off, 1996 Nissan Primera is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1994 BMW 735.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1994 BMW 735 would be higher. At 3,430 cc (6 cylinders), 1994 BMW 735 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1994 BMW 735 (208 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 107 more horse power than 1996 Nissan Primera. (101 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1994 BMW 735 should accelerate faster than 1996 Nissan Primera.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1994 BMW 735 weights approximately 656 kg more than 1996 Nissan Primera.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1994 BMW 735 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1994 BMW 735.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1996 Nissan Primera,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1994 BMW 735 (305 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 169 more torque (in Nm) than 1996 Nissan Primera. (136 Nm @ 4800 RPM). This means 1994 BMW 735 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1996 Nissan Primera.

Compare all specifications:

1994 BMW 735 1996 Nissan Primera
Make BMW Nissan
Model 735 Primera
Year Released 1994 1996
Body Type Sedan Sedan
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3430 cc 1597 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 208 HP 101 HP
Engine RPM 5700 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 305 Nm 136 Nm
Torque RPM 4000 RPM 4800 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Front
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Doors 4 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1820 kg 1164 kg
Vehicle Length 5130 mm 4410 mm
Vehicle Width 1870 mm 1710 mm
Vehicle Height 1430 mm 1400 mm
Wheelbase Size 2940 mm 2610 mm
